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7155 509 4737 410133
1955711473 18079 31
1955711473 18079 31
93039 52 8989 893378
All about undefined
Interested in learning more?
1955711473 18079 31
93039 52 8989 893378
See more
99452225 729027 062401270
1662110 50881 9140087643
See more
813291802 9148471
704940431 530389900 137359193
See more